Aide Algo Somme Des Chiffres D'un Nombre

Sunday, 7 July 2024

h> #include #include int main() { int A, S=0, I; printf("Taper un nombre.... "); scanf("%d", &A); while (A > 0) S = S + A%10; A = A / 10;} printf("%d", S); return 0;} - Edité par MEGHNI 24 octobre 2015 à 1:09:26 24 octobre 2015 à 1:09:48 Re, MEGHNI a écrit: Je viens d'essayer ce code, ça ne marche pas correctement Ça, ce n'est pas correct. Algorithme somme des chiffres d un nombre en. Faut peut-être dire ce que passe: ça plante, résultat bizarre, résultat non prévu, etc.... Bon, à part ça: ligne 14: tu ne compares pas, tu assignes.... EDIT: mwouai, post edit par le PO. Ma réponse n'a plus rien à voir.... - Edité par edgarjacobs 24 octobre 2015 à 1:13:01 24 octobre 2015 à 3:52:29 Pour info, mes deux idées d'algorithmes étaient: ─ extraire les chiffres un par un à coups de modulo 10, ce que tu as fait; ─ transformer le nombre en chaîne de caractères puis extraire chaque caractère et les retransformer un nombre pour les sommer. ×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.

  1. Algorithme somme des chiffres d un nombre reel
  2. Algorithme somme des chiffres d un nombre relatifs
  3. Algorithme somme des chiffres d un nombre en

Algorithme Somme Des Chiffres D Un Nombre Reel

×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.

Algorithme Somme Des Chiffres D Un Nombre Relatifs

Calcul de somme des chiffres de nombre 2^1000 - Mathématiques Programmation Algorithmique 2D-3D-Jeux Assembleur C C++ D Go Kotlin Objective C Pascal Perl Python Rust Swift Qt XML Autres Navigation Inscrivez-vous gratuitement p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ter Sujet: Mathématiques 26/02/2012, 13h27 #1 Membre à l'essai Calcul de somme des chiffres de nombre 2^1000 bjr; je cherche un algorithme qui permet de calculer la somme des chiffres de nombre obtenu par le calcule de 2^1000. 26/02/2012, 15h52 #2 Membre averti Bonjour, Ce n'est pas le produit plutôt? Sinon je n'ai pas compris la question, j'ai besoin d'éclaircissement. Un Algorithme Qui Donne La Somme Des Chiffre D Un Nombre De Deux Chiffre.pdf notice & manuel d'utilisation. 26/02/2012, 18h40 #3 Le plus simple c'est de calculer 2^1000 (en base 10) et d'additionner les chiffres. Ca necessite d'utiliser une librairie qui gère les grands entiers, soit en binaire, soit en BCD. ALGORITHME (n. m. ): Méthode complexe de résolution d'un problème simple.

Algorithme Somme Des Chiffres D Un Nombre En

Étant donné un nombre, trouver la somme de ses chiffres. Exemples: Input: n = 687 Output: 21 Input: n = 12 Output: 3 Recommandé: Veuillez d'abord le résoudre sur « PRATIQUE » avant de passer à la solution. Algorithme général pour la somme des chiffres d'un nombre donné: Obtenez le numéro Déclarez une variable pour stocker la somme et définissez-la sur 0 Répétez les deux étapes suivantes jusqu'à ce que le nombre ne soit pas 0 Obtenez le chiffre le plus à droite du nombre à l'aide du reste de l'opérateur '%' en le divisant par 10 et en l'ajoutant à la somme. Divisez le nombre par 10 à l'aide de l'opérateur '/' pour supprimer le chiffre le plus à droite. La somme des chiffres d'un entier. Imprimer ou retourner la somme Voici les solutions pour obtenir la somme des chiffres. 1. Itératif: // C program to compute sum of digits in // number. #include using namespace std; /* Function to get sum of digits */ class gfg { public: int getSum(int n) { int sum = 0; while (n! = 0) { sum = sum + n% 10; n = n / 10;} return sum;}}; // Driver code int main() gfg g; int n = 687; cout << (n); return 0;} // This code is contributed by Soumik #include

Vous voulez apprendre des meilleures vidéos et des problèmes de pratique, consultez le cours C Foundation pour Basic à Advanced C.